Titanium Dioxide…
This product reminded me a lot of calamine lotion and another popular drying lotion. The color beige instead of pink (because there is no calamine) but just like in those it does contain zinc oxide which I think gives it a similar smell.It has a lot of great natural ingredients, except for titanium dioxide. The International Agency for Research on Cancer designates titanium dioxide as a carcinogen due to studies that have found increased lung cancers in animals after inhalation exposure. So do with that info what you will.I did try out this product on a couple spots that needed to be drained. I applied the “potion” for 20 minutes as suggested and wiped away and it really did reduce the redness quite a bit. The pimple looked smaller in size I was really impressed. I’m just not sure I want to continue using this giving the ingredient in question… It really doesn’t need to be in there because the purpose is usually just to add a white color…
